Tip Number 1

Network like a pro! Connect with local builders, contractors, and even your previous clients. Word of mouth is powerful, and you never know who might need a tiler next.

Tip Number 2

Show off your skills! Create a portfolio showcasing your best work. High-quality photos of your tiling projects can really help you stand out when potential clients are browsing through options.

Tip Number 3

Stay active on our platform! Regularly check for new job postings and respond quickly. The sooner you apply, the better your chances of landing that gig!

Tip Number 4

Don’t forget to ask for reviews! After completing a job, kindly request feedback from your clients. Positive reviews can boost your profile and attract more customers looking for a reliable tiler.

How to prepare for a job interview at United Cerebral Palsy of Georgia

Showcase Your Experience

Make sure to highlight your three years of tiling experience during the interview. Bring along a portfolio of your previous work, including photos and client testimonials, to demonstrate your skills and reliability.

Know Your Insurance

Since Public Liability Insurance is a must, be prepared to discuss your coverage in detail. This shows that you take your responsibilities seriously and are ready to protect both yourself and your clients.

Be Ready for Practical Questions

Expect questions about your approach to different tiling projects. Think about how you would handle various scenarios, such as dealing with difficult surfaces or tight deadlines, and be ready to share your problem-solving strategies.

Express Your Flexibility

Emphasise your willingness to take on jobs at different times and your ability to adapt to various project requirements. This flexibility is key for a freelance role and will show that you're committed to maximising opportunities through their platform.
